網(wǎng)上有很多關(guān)于pos機(jī)定位不準(zhǔn),PR[ ]位置寄存器的知識(shí),也有很多人為大家解答關(guān)于pos機(jī)定位不準(zhǔn)的問(wèn)題,今天pos機(jī)之家(m.nxzs9ef.cn)為大家整理了關(guān)于這方面的知識(shí),讓我們一起來(lái)看下吧!
本文目錄一覽:
pos機(jī)定位不準(zhǔn)
位置寄存器指令
位置寄存器指令,是進(jìn)行位置寄存器的算術(shù)運(yùn)算的指令。位置寄存器指令可進(jìn)行代入、加算、減算處理,以與寄存器指令相同的方式記述。
位置寄存器,是用來(lái)存儲(chǔ)位置資料(x,y,z,w,p,r)的變量(有關(guān)位置寄存器)。標(biāo)準(zhǔn)情況下提供有 100 個(gè)位置寄存器。
注釋:
使用位置寄存器指令之前,通過(guò)“LOCK PREG”來(lái)鎖定位置寄存器。若沒(méi)有進(jìn)行鎖定,動(dòng)作可能會(huì)集中在一起。有關(guān)“LOCK PREG”指令,可參閱 9.6 位置寄存器先執(zhí)行功能。
PR[i] =(值)
PR[i] =(值)指令,將位置資料代入位置寄存器。
PR[i]=(值)
i :
位置寄存器號(hào)碼(1~100)
值:
PR [ i ]:位置寄存器[i]的值
P[ i ]:程序內(nèi)的示教位置[i]的值
LPOS:當(dāng)前位置的直角坐標(biāo)值
JPOS:當(dāng)前位置的關(guān)節(jié)坐標(biāo)值
UFRAME[ i ]:用戶坐標(biāo)系[i]的值
UTOOL[ i ]:工具坐標(biāo)系[i]的值
例
1: PR[1]= LPOS
2: PR[R[4]]= UFRAME[R[1]]
3: PR[GP1: 9]= UTOOL[GP1: 1]
PR[i] =(值)+(值)
PR[i] =(值)+(值)指令,代入2個(gè)值的和。
PR[i] =(值)-(值)指令,代入2個(gè)值的差。
PR[i]=(值) (算符)(值) (算符) (值)...
PR[ i ]:位置寄存器[i]的值
P[ i ]:程序內(nèi)示教位置[i]的值
LPOS:直角坐標(biāo)系中的當(dāng)前位置
JPOS:關(guān)節(jié)坐標(biāo)系中的當(dāng)前位置
UFRAME[ i ]:用戶坐標(biāo)系[i]的值
UTOOL[ i ]:工具坐標(biāo)系[i]的值
例
4: PR[3] = PR[3]+LPOS
5: PR[4] = PR[ R[1] ]
位置寄存器要素指令
位置寄存器要素指令,是進(jìn)行位置寄存器的算術(shù)運(yùn)算的指令。
PR[i,j]的i表示位置寄存器號(hào)碼,j表示位置寄存器的要素號(hào)碼。位置寄存器要素指令可進(jìn)行代入、加算、減算處理,以與數(shù)值寄存器指令相同的方式記述。
PR[i,j] =(值)
PR[i,j] =(值)指令,將位置資料的要素值代入位置寄存器要素
例1: PR[1, 1]= R[3]
2: PR[4, 3]= 324.5
PR[i,j] =(值)+(值)
PR[i,j] =(值)+(值)指令,將2個(gè)值的和代入位置寄存器要素。
PR[i,j] =(值)-(值)
PR[i,j] =(值)-(值)指令,將2個(gè)值得差代入位置寄存器要素。
PR[i,j] =(值)*(值)
PR[i,j] =(值)*(值)指令,將2個(gè)值的積代入位置寄存器要素。
PR[i,j] =(值)/(值)
PR[i,j] =(值)/(值)指令,將2個(gè)值的商代入位置寄存器要素。
PR[i,j] =(值)MOD(值)
PR[i,j] =(值)MOD(值)指令,將2個(gè)值的余數(shù)代入位置寄存器要素。
PR[i,j] =(值)DIV(值)
PR[i,j] =(值)DIV(值)指令,將2個(gè)值的商的整數(shù)值部分代入位置寄存器要素。
以上就是關(guān)于pos機(jī)定位不準(zhǔn),PR[ ]位置寄存器的知識(shí),后面我們會(huì)繼續(xù)為大家整理關(guān)于pos機(jī)定位不準(zhǔn)的知識(shí),希望能夠幫助到大家!









